Why Do Clear Phone Cases Turn Yellow?
Before diving into restoration tips, it's helpful to understand why clear cases turn yellow in the first place. Most clear phone cases are made of polyurethane (TPU) or polycarbonate (PC), materials prone to oxidation when exposed to light, heat, and oils from your skin. This natural aging process results in discoloration. Additionally, dirt, grime, and exposure to environmental factors can dull your case's appearance.
1. Gather the Right Cleaning Supplies
Restoring your clear phone case doesn’t require expensive materials. Most cleaning can be done using items you already have at home, such as:
-
Mild dish soap
-
Baking soda
-
White vinegar
-
Soft-bristled toothbrush or sponge
-
Microfiber cloth
Having these supplies on hand ensures you can tackle grime and stains effectively without damaging the material of your thin phone case.
2. Clean Your Case Thoroughly
Start with a basic cleaning routine:
-
Step 1: Remove the Case: Take the clear case off your phone to avoid moisture damage to your device.
-
Step 2: Wash with Soap and Water: Mix a few drops of mild dish soap with warm water. Submerge the case and scrub gently using a soft-bristled toothbrush or sponge. This effectively clears away surface grime and oils..
-
Step 3: Rinse and Dry: Rinse the case thoroughly under cool water to remove soap residue. Pat it dry with a microfiber cloth and allow it to air dry completely before reattaching it to your phone.
3. Tackle Yellowing with Baking Soda
For more stubborn discoloration, baking soda is an effective remedy:
-
Sprinkle a generous amount of baking soda onto the case.
-
Scrub the case gently in circular motions with a damp toothbrush, paying extra attention to the discolored spots.
-
Rinse thoroughly and dry.
This method works well for TPU cases, which are more prone to yellowing.
4. Use White Vinegar for Tough Stains
White vinegar is excellent for removing stubborn grime or stains that soap alone can’t handle. To clean your thin phone case:
-
Mix equal parts white vinegar and water in a bowl.
-
Submerge the case and let it soak for 30 minutes.
-
Gently scrub any lingering stains using a toothbrush..
-
Rinse and dry the case completely.
5. Polish Out Scratches
Scratches can make a clear phone case look cloudy. To minimize scratches:
-
Use a small amount of plastic polish or toothpaste (non-gel variety).
-
Apply the product to the scratched area and gently buff with a microfiber cloth.
-
Wipe away any residue and inspect the case.
Repeat the process if needed, but avoid being too aggressive, as excessive polishing can damage the case.
6. Protect Your Case for the Future
Once restored, take steps to keep your thin phone case looking new for longer:
-
Avoid Direct Sunlight: Prolonged UV exposure accelerates yellowing.
-
Regular Maintenance: Use a damp cloth to wipe your case weekly and keep dirt and oils at bay.
-
Handle with Clean Hands: This reduces the transfer of grime and oils to the case.
-
Use Anti-Yellowing Sprays: Consider applying a UV-resistant spray designed for phone cases.
When to Replace Your Case
While regular cleaning and maintenance can significantly extend the life of your thin phone case, it’s important to recognize when it’s time for a replacement. If the case is cracked, warped, or too yellowed to restore, investing in a new one is the best option to maintain your phone’s aesthetics and protection.
